Brooksby Village by Erickson Senior Living

We are hiring a Community Resources Coordinator to bring their passion for resident engagement to our campus. This is an entry level position offering growth opportunity and career advancement.

In this role, you would act as a resource for residents in the creation of activities and social organizations within the independent living community, serve as the welcome home ambassador for incoming/ new residents, maintain calendar bookings for all meeting space, fields resident inquiries, and special projects as assigned.

To be successful in this role requires a strong team player with a high level of enthusiasm, a can-do attitude, and strong organizational skills. Must have solid computer skills and easily adapt to new technology and systems.

Compensation: commensurate with experience $21-$25/ hour

What we offer
  • A culture of diversity, inclusion, equity and belonging, which builds on our mission, vision and values
  • Medical, dental and vision packages, including an annual reimbursement for qualified wellness expenses, personal health coaching and telemedicine options
  • PTO Plans, PLUS company paid volunteer hours for eligible team members, in accordance with applicable state law
  • 401k for all team members 18 and over with a company 3% match
  • Onsite medical centers, providing wellness visits and sick care for all team members over 18 years of age
  • 30% discount on food and drinks at on-site dining venues, plus additional healthy choice meal options at discounted prices
  • Education assistance, certification reimbursement and access to over 6,000 courses through our online learning library, designed to enhance your current skills and build new ones
  • Growth Opportunities – grow with the company as we open new communities and expand on our existing ones!
How you will make an impact
  • Partner with residents in the planning, promoting, and coordinating of activities and events in the community
  • Perform preliminary work for monthly calendars
  • Facilitate communication regarding activities among residents and staff
  • Create flyers for events; writing articles for community bulletins
  • Arrange audio/visual equipment with vendors for presentations
  • Serve as the information center for resident inquiries
What you will need
  • Minimum of 3 years of experience in service-related roles, including volunteer work or public service
  • Previous experience working with senior citizens is preferred
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office, particularly in Publisher, PowerPoint, Word, and Excel

Brooksby Village is a beautiful 90-acre continuing care retirement community located in Peabody, Massachusetts, just minutes from Boston. We’re part of a growing national network of communities managed by Erickson Senior Living, one of the country’s largest and most respected providers of senior living and health care. Brooksby Village helps people live better lives by fulfilling our promises of a vibrant lifestyle, financial stability, and focused health and well-being services for those who live and work with us.
